SAP环境下Oracle表维护的关键SQL脚本

版权申诉
0 下载量 195 浏览量 更新于2024-10-25 收藏 20KB ZIP 举报
资源摘要信息:"SAP_very_useful_Oracle_SQL_cmd.zip_SAP_SAP rebuild index_Table" ### 标题分析: 标题中提到的"SAP_very_useful_Oracle_SQL_cmd.zip_SAP_SAP rebuild index_Table"暗示了这个压缩包包含了与SAP系统和Oracle数据库相关的一系列有用的SQL命令或脚本,特别是针对表(Table)和索引(Index)的操作,如重建索引。这里的"rebuild index"指的是对Oracle数据库中索引的重建操作,这是数据库管理中常用的一项任务,用于优化索引性能,消除数据碎片。 ### 描述分析: 描述中提到了"Useful SQL commands or scripts to alter Oracle table used for SAP",这意味着文件夹中的SQL命令和脚本是用来修改Oracle数据库中的表,这些表是由SAP系统使用或管理的。在SAP系统中,Oracle数据库的表结构和性能优化尤为重要,因为SAP应用通常是数据密集型的,并且对数据库性能有很高的要求。 ### 标签分析: 标签"sap sap_rebuild_index table"明确指出了这些SQL命令和脚本与SAP、重建索引以及表操作相关。在SAP环境中,经常需要进行表和索引的维护任务,以确保系统的高效运行。 ### 压缩文件内容分析: - **unlock shadow instance.doc**:可能是一个关于如何解锁Oracle数据库的阴影实例(shadow instance)的文档。在Oracle RAC(Real Application Clusters)环境中,阴影实例用于存储全局资源信息。如果在高可用性环境中遇到实例锁定问题,该文档可能提供了解决方案。 - **sapconn_role.sql**:这个SQL脚本文件可能是用来创建或管理名为“sapconn”的角色,该角色可能与SAP系统的数据库连接权限相关。 - **Security_request_AGR_1251.sql**:这个文件可能包含创建或修改Oracle系统权限的脚本,AGR_1251通常与SAP安全相关,可能涉及到与特定权限或授权问题相关的命令。 - **sqlplus-tips.txt**:可能是一个包含关于如何有效使用sqlplus(Oracle的命令行界面工具)的提示和技巧的文本文件。 - **reset a password ofr a SAP_user.txt**:这个文本文件可能描述了如何重置一个SAP用户的密码。在SAP系统中,用户管理是常见的维护任务。 - **Reactivate_a_bad_client_mandant_in_SAP.txt**:可能包含有关如何重新激活SAP系统中出现故障的客户(client)或mandant(可能是特定区域或客户的配置单位)的指导。 - **rollback_fin_8i.txt**:这个文件可能涉及到Oracle 8i版本的事务回滚操作的说明,特别是在SAP环境中遇到的财务相关的事务回滚。 - **SDBAC_modification_table_DB13.txt**:可能包含对于SDBAC(SAP Database Administrator Console)的表修改说明,DB13是可能的SAP数据库标识。 - **tablespace_size.txt**:可能是一个文本文件,包含了检查和调整Oracle数据库表空间大小的方法。 - **rebuild_obsolete_index.sql.txt**:这个文件包含了重建过时或不再使用的索引的SQL脚本,这有助于提高数据库性能。 ### 知识点总结: 1. **Oracle数据库维护**:Oracle数据库的维护工作是SAP系统稳定运行的关键,其中包括索引重建、表空间管理、权限管理等。 2. **SAP系统数据库操作**:SAP系统中的数据库操作通常涉及到用户管理、系统安全、故障排除等。 3. **Oracle脚本编写**:使用SQL脚本来自动化数据库的维护任务可以提高效率,确保操作的一致性和准确性。 4. **文档和说明的编写**:相关文档和说明的编写对于维护人员来说是必需的,它们提供了详细的步骤和注意事项。 5. **Oracle数据字典视图**:理解并使用Oracle提供的数据字典视图来获取数据库对象信息和系统性能指标。 6. **SAP用户权限管理**:在SAP系统中,用户权限管理涉及到用户身份验证、授权和安全性的维护。 7. **备份与恢复策略**:在SAP系统中实现有效的备份与恢复策略,以应对数据丢失或系统故障的情况。 8. **事务回滚**:在财务或关键操作中,理解如何正确使用事务回滚来撤销错误的数据库更改。 9. **Oracle版本特定操作**:了解不同版本的Oracle数据库(如8i)中的特定操作和兼容性问题。 10. **性能监控与调优**:监控数据库性能并根据需要进行调优,包括索引优化,以提高系统响应速度和效率。 通过以上知识点,我们可以对SAP系统和Oracle数据库管理有一个全面的认识,并且理解这些压缩文件中的内容是如何帮助维护和优化SAP系统中的Oracle数据库的。